The Jörmungandr Mechanism, which appears at the end of Tomb Raider Underworld, is a device associated with the Midgard Serpent and whose activation can bring about Ragnarok, the Norse end of the world. Its builders and purpose are unclear. Fan speculation has attributed the creation of the Mechanism to either: (a) Atlanteans, (b) a pre-Atlantean race, or (c) Thor, and the generally accepted role for the Mechanism is that it is some sort of deterrent Doomsday device.

Jörmungandr, the Midgard Serpent

In Norse mythology Jörmungandr ['jœrmuŋgandr], alternately referred to as the Midgard Serpent (Midgardsormr) or World Serpent, is a sea serpent, the middle child of the giantess Angrboða and the god Loki[1]. According to the Prose Edda, Odin took Loki's three children, Fenrisúlfr, Hel and Jörmungandr. He tossed Jörmungandr into the great ocean that encircles Midgard. The serpent grew so big that he was able to surround the Earth and grasp his own tail. Jörmungandr's arch enemy is the god Thor.
